Vera had a solid showing at the 2011 USTA/ITA Northeast Regional Championships hosted by William Smith College. The sophomore went 3-1 in singles competition, while posting a 1-1 record in doubles competition.
In singles, Vera defeated Jennifer Kraham of Hunter College 6-4, 6-0 in her first round match. She went on to beat Alyssa Tretter of Cortland State 6-2, 6-1 in the second round. She posted a three-set win in the third round 5-7, 6-4, 6-1 over Hillary Drewry of St. Lawrence. In the quarterfinals Vera was defeated by Nataly Mendoza of Skidmore 6-1, 0-6, 6-1.
In doubles, Vera along with teammate Liz Uhrinec defeated the team of Ramya Pokala and Alexandra Ziarko of NYU 8-3 in their first round match. The duo were defeated by Paige Aiello and Deborah Wu from The College of New Jersey 8-0 in the second round.
